The station boasts a well-staffed ticket office open from the early morning through the evening, alongside ticket machines that are equipped to handle smartcard validations. This makes last-minute ticket purchases or collections a breeze. Importantly, all machines cater to the needs of disabled passengers, offering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
Accessibility is top-notch, with step-free access available across the station, making it easy for passengers with limited mobility to navigate. An accessible waiting room and toilets further enhance the convenience. For cyclists, the station provides storage for up to 192 bicycles in a secured, CCTV-monitored cycle hub.

London Road (Guildford) station is well-equipped for your travel needs. The ticket office is open from 06:30 to 13:00 on weekdays and 09:00 to 14:00 on Saturdays. While there's no ticket office service on Sundays, ticket machines are available for you to buy and collect tickets at any time. Additionally, these machines are accessible for individuals with disabilities, and induction loops are available for those with hearing impairments.
The station features heated waiting rooms on both platforms and CCTV for your safety. However, it's worth noting that facilities such as shops, ATM machines, and refreshment outlets are not available on-site, so it's a good idea to plan ahead if you require these services.
This station prioritizes accessibility with some step-free access available. While platform 2, which services trains towards Guildford, offers level access, platform 1 does not have step-free access. Assistance for boarding or alighting from trains is handled by the train's guard, and while dedicated staff help isn't available, customer help points are on site to assist passengers.
Accessible parking is available with two designated spaces, though you might want to confirm details ahead as equipment for accessible parking is not provided.
